Samsung is set to release a new type of foldable smartphone that folds into three sections. The device, known as the “Galaxy G Fold,” has a 9.96-inch display when fully unfolded and can be viewed from both sides. This design differentiates it from Huawei’s Mate XT Ultimate, which unfolds in sequence.
The naming scheme is unclear, with many questioning why Samsung chose to use the “G” instead of the “Z,” which is already associated with its existing foldable lineup. The device will reportedly have a thicker profile than Huawei’s counterpart.
Despite the confusion surrounding the name, details about the Galaxy G Fold are becoming clearer. The smartphone is expected to be unveiled later this year ahead of a launch in early 2026.
